Innovative Technology Behind Solar Panel Efficiency

You know, the tech behind how efficient solar panels have become has seriously come a long way in just a few years. It’s pretty exciting because now they’re more accessible and actually work better for both folks at home and businesses. One of the coolest upgrades is these bifacial solar panels — they can soak up sunlight from both sides, which means they pump out way more energy than your usual single-sided panels. Plus, they catch the reflected sunlight bouncing off surfaces around them, so they’re just overall more efficient — stuff we couldn’t really dream of before.

And it’s not just the dual-sided thing. Researchers have also made some seriously impressive advances with the materials inside these panels. For example, perovskite solar cells have been a big deal lately because they can reach high efficiency while costing less to produce. Not only do they convert sunlight to electricity really well, but they’re also pretty versatile — you can put them on all sorts of surfaces and in different kinds of projects. As scientists keep pushing the limits, the future of solar tech looks super bright. Honestly, it’s becoming such a key part of how we’re moving toward renewable energy — which is pretty awesome.

Economic Benefits of Investing in Solar Energy

Investing in solar energy? Honestly, it's a no-brainer when you think about the huge economic perks. I mean, according to a report from the International Renewable Energy Agency (IRENA), for every dollar you put into solar projects, you could see around $3.28 in return over the system’s lifetime. That’s pretty impressive, right? It really highlights how financially viable solar is, not just for big companies but also for everyday folks and small businesses—saving money on energy bills and all. Plus, as more people jump on the solar bandwagon worldwide, job opportunities in this field are expected to skyrocket. The Solar Foundation’s National Solar Jobs Census suggests we could be looking at over 24 million jobs by 2030, which is exciting!

If you're thinking about going solar, don’t forget to check out what kind of local incentives or rebates you might be eligible for. Tons of governments offer tax credits or grants that can cut down your initial costs quite a bit. In the U.S., for example, there's this federal solar tax credit that lets homeowners deduct a good chunk of their installation costs from their taxes — bonus savings on those electricity bills!

Oh, and if the upfront costs seem daunting, don’t worry. There are options like solar leases or power purchase agreements (PPAs) that let you tap into solar power without having to fork out a bunch of cash right away. These kinds of financial setups are really making solar more accessible and pushing it further into the mainstream. Basically, understanding all these economic perks can help you make smarter choices—whether for your home or your business—benefits that go beyond just saving money, and really help build a more sustainable future. Pretty cool, right?

Environmental Impact: Reducing Carbon Footprint

You know, the environmental impact of solar panels is pretty significant, mainly because they can really cut down on our carbon footprint. I mean, traditional energy sources like fossil fuels dump tons of carbon dioxide and other greenhouse gases into the air, which is a major cause of global warming and climate change. On the flip side, solar panels generate power without releasing those nasty pollutants during operation. Switching to renewable energy like this not only helps protect our planet but also means cleaner air and healthier ecosystems—pretty awesome, right?

Plus, the way solar panels are built today is getting way more sustainable. Thanks to tech improvements, they’re more efficient at capturing solar energy and require fewer resources to make. Most modern panels can last around 25 years or even longer, and as recycling tech gets better, we can reuse the materials, cutting down on waste. When folks and communities start investing in solar, they’re really making a difference by relying less on polluting energy sources. It’s all about contributing to a more sustainable, eco-friendly future, one panel at a time.

Harness the Power of the Sun: A Comprehensive Guide to SHSS500 Series Solar Pump Inverter Solutions

Harnessing the power of the sun has never been more vital, especially in the realm of sustainable energy solutions. The SHSS500 Series Solar Pump Inverter exemplifies this approach, utilizing MPPT (Maximum Power Point Tracking) technology and advanced motor drive capabilities to optimize solar panel performance. According to industry reports, solar energy systems can reduce operational costs by up to 75% when harnessed effectively, making solar pump inverters an attractive option for both agricultural and municipal applications.

The versatility of the SHSS500 inverters stands out with their compatibility with both AC and DC inputs. This enables the inverters to power a wide variety of standard AC pumps, providing flexibility in installation and operational efficiency. When solar power is insufficient, the inverter seamlessly transitions to utility power, ensuring consistent performance. Additionally, with built-in self-checking features to monitor conditions such as dry running and weak sunlight, the SHSS500 Series ensures reliability and longevity. Reports indicate that systems equipped with comprehensive protection can reduce maintenance costs by up to 30%, further enhancing the overall efficiency of solar pumping solutions.

Moreover, the SHSS500 inverters are designed with user convenience in mind. The motor Soft Start Function minimizes the mechanical stress on pumps during startup, while speed control functions allow for optimized water flow rates based on demand.
